1 definition by sweetjsour

A person who is very nice and offers many compliments to Jennifers. A Charles may talk up to 8 hours (maybe more) on the phone. Charles may be shortened to "Char Char" or called "Char Char" like how the pokemon Charmander says "Char Char."
Hey Jamil's Cousin. I mean Charles.
by sweetjsour August 15, 2006
Get the Charles mug.